An Overview of General TiO2 Manufacturers


Titanium Dioxide, commonly referred to as TiO2, is a versatile and highly valued compound that serves primarily as a white pigment and is widely used in various industries. Its application spans from paints and coatings to plastics and paper, as well as cosmetics and food products. The global demand for TiO2 has significantly increased, leading to a robust market with several major manufacturers dominating the industry. Production Techniques

The production of titanium dioxide can be categorized into two primary methods the sulfate process and the chloride process.


- Sulfate Process This method involves the reaction of titanium ore (often ilmenite) with sulfuric acid. The process is relatively cost-effective but produces a significant amount of waste, leading to environmental concerns. Nevertheless, it is a widely adopted technique, particularly in low-cost regions.


- Chloride Process In contrast, the chloride process utilizes titanium tetrachloride, derived from rutile, which is more refined and results in a purer form of TiO2 with less environmental impact. However, this method requires higher capital investment and advanced technology, making it more common among leading manufacturers.


Market Trends and Future Outlook


As sustainability becomes a critical concern for industries worldwide, TiO2 manufacturers are increasingly adopting eco-friendly practices. Innovations in production techniques that reduce waste and energy consumption are gaining traction. Additionally, the trend of circular economy principles, such as recycling titanium materials and utilizing waste products, is becoming more prevalent.


The growth of green technologies, such as solar energy systems that use TiO2 in photovoltaic cells, has also widened the market. The demand for titanium dioxide in industries focused on renewable energy and environmental sustainability is projected to rise significantly.


Moreover, regulations regarding the safety and environmental impact of chemicals, including TiO2, are evolving. Manufacturers are therefore compelled to adapt to these regulations to maintain compliance and enhance their product offerings.
